Serial Number Information
The serial number plate is typically located on the left-hand side of the undercarriage frame or near the operator cab step.
Use the machine's serial number to confirm compatibility with parts for engine, hydraulics, and undercarriage systems.
Key Specifications
Engine
| Feature |
Specification |
| Model |
Yanmar 4TNV88, 4-cylinder diesel |
| Displacement |
2,189 cm³ |
| Power Output |
28.2 kW (37.8 HP) @ 2,400 RPM |
| Cooling |
Water-cooled |
Operating Weight & Dimensions
| Feature |
Specification |
| Operating Weight |
5,280 kg (11,640 lbs) |
| Tail Swing Radius |
Zero tail swing |
| Fuel Capacity |
83 liters (22 gallons) |
Performance & Digging Specs
| Feature |
Specification |
| Max Dig Depth |
3,750 mm (12.3 ft) with long dipperstick |
| Max Ground Reach |
6,100 mm (20.0 ft) |
| Max Dumping Height |
3,680 mm (12.1 ft) |
Hydraulic System
| Feature |
Specification |
| Flow Rate |
167.1 L/min (44 GPM) |
| Operating Pressure |
240 bar (3,481 psi) |
Travel Specs
| Feature |
Specification |
| Travel Speed |
Up to 4.6 km/h (2.9 mph) |
Key Features
Zero Tail Swing Maneuverability
The 50Z3’s compact design allows full cab rotation within the track width, making it perfect for working alongside walls, fences, or in congested urban zones.
High-Performance Yanmar Engine
The 4TNV88 diesel engine delivers 37.8 HP, combining quiet operation, fuel efficiency, and long service life in one compact package.
Extended Digging Reach
With a long dipperstick, this mini excavator achieves a digging depth of 12.3 ft and a reach of 20 ft, offering performance beyond its size.
Efficient Hydraulics
The 44 GPM hydraulic system at 3,481 psi provides the muscle for quick cycle times and responsive control over bucket and boom operations.

Maintenance Schedule
| Task |
Recommended Interval |
| Engine Oil & Filter |
Every 250 hours |
| Fuel Filter Replacement |
Every 250 hours |
| Hydraulic Oil & Filter |
Every 500 hours |
| Coolant Flush |
Annually or every 1,000 hours |
| Track Tension Check |
Weekly or after intense use |
| Swing Bearing Grease |
Every 50 hours |
